Putting your iPhone 11 into recovery mode is essential for troubleshooting various issues. Here’s a quick guide to help you through the process:
- Connect to Computer: Use a USB cable to connect your iPhone 11 to a computer.
- Open iTunes/Finder: Launch iTunes on Windows or Finder on macOS Catalina and later.
- Quickly Press Buttons: Rapidly press and release the Volume Up button, then do the same with the Volume Down button.
- Press and Hold Side Button: Hold the Side button until you see the recovery mode screen.
- Restore or Update: Choose to update or restore your iPhone in iTunes/Finder.
With these steps, your iPhone 11 should be in recovery mode for any necessary updates or fixes.
